Unlocking Insights: A Guide to Effective Productivity Reporting

maximize your team's output by harnessing the power of impactful productivity reporting. A well-crafted report can uncover hidden trends, pinpoint areas for growth, and ultimately fuel progress towards your team goals.

Begin by defining key KPIs that correspond with your strategic objectives. Emphasize on metrics that quantify the tasks most significant to your outcomes.

Employ a versatile reporting system that supports clear display of data. Graphs can comprehensively transmit complex information in a understandable manner.

Don't overlook the importance of storytelling. Integrate data trends into a engaging narrative that highlights the impact of your team's work. A well-crafted story can inspire stakeholders and drive action.

Harnessing Data for Optimal Performance: Productivity Reporting Strategies

Data analysis analyzing is a essential component of any effective organization. By leveraging data effectively, businesses can gain invaluable insights into employee productivity and reveal areas for improvement. Robust productivity reporting approaches provide a systematic framework for collecting data, interpreting trends, and creating actionable insights.

A well-designed productivity reporting system should monitor key data points such as project milestones, hours dedicated, and employee engagement. Examining these metrics over time can uncover patterns and shifts that may not be easily apparent.

By interpreting these trends, organizations can adopt targeted interventions to improve productivity. Meaningful productivity reporting goes beyond simply assembling data; it entails a proactive approach to identifying areas for development and fostering continuous improvement.

Always, the goal of productivity reporting is to translate data into meaningful insights that can inform organizational decisions. By adopting a insight-focused approach, organizations can enhance productivity and accomplish their business goals.
